What the Data Says About Mayo Clinic

Mayo Clinic operating in MN within the Healthcare & Social Assistance sector appears across multiple federal and state datasets that every job seeker, investigative reporter, and compliance researcher should know about. The company has filed 178 H-1B labor condition applications with a median disclosed wage of $170,078. Records here combine U.S. Department of Labor disclosures and state workforce agency filings. Each row on this page is sourced directly from a public government record, not a paid vendor or crowd-sourced review site, so the numbers reflect legally filed disclosures rather than opinion.

On workplace safety, Mayo Clinic posted a DART (Days Away, Restricted, Transferred) rate of 1.22 injuries per 100 full-time workers, compared with an industry peer average of 0.74. Our composite grade of "D" translates that raw rate into a relative benchmark so a job seeker can compare a hospital chain to a warehouse or a bank to a food processor without chasing down OSHA formulas. Across all years on file, OSHA logged 2,703 reportable injuries at this employer.

The layoff history is material here: 2 WARN Act notices affecting 10 workers have been filed against Mayo Clinic. The WARN Act requires 60 days of advance notice before mass layoffs or plant closings at employers with 100 or more workers, and those notices are filed publicly with state workforce agencies. A clustered pattern of notices often precedes earnings downgrades, bankruptcy filings, or private-equity-driven restructurings, so prospective employees should weigh this history alongside salary and safety data when evaluating an offer.
